Wiley Rein LLP government contracts practice delivers end-to-end counsel across the full procurement lifecycle, including new market entry, entity formation, contract performance, expansion through acquisition and sale of government contractors. The team is particularly well regarded for its strength in bid protests, contract claims, cost matters and compliance counselling. Based in Washington DC, the practice is led by Scott McCaleb and Paul Khoury. McCaleb is an experienced litigator recognised for his work on complex investigations and disputes involving aerospace and defense contractors. Khoury advises defense and civilian contractors on compliance and enforcement matters including mandatory disclosures, false claims act allegations and debarment proceedings. Tracye Howard brings substantial experience litigating claims under the Contract Disputes Act and related disputes, while Jon Burd is noted for his work in bid protests, claims and appeals. Brian Walsh excels in strategic counselling to aid clients navigate emerging regulatory challenges. John Prairie and Ryan Frazee departed the firm in 2025.
